    Default Audio issues under power lines

    We are on the hot side of Lake Anna in VA, and we have huge power lines that span over the water. When I drive under the power lines, my tower audio cuts out, and it causes issues with the head unit and the ipod that i have connected. I usually have to turn everything off and on again, unplug the ipod, etc.
    The stereo sounds fine otherwise. Do I need to rewire the tower speakers or start looking at ground wiring etc.? This is on an 05 21V.

    Your dealing with some serious Electro Magnetic Energy (EME), there may not be anything you can do besides sheilded all of the power, control, and speaker wiring with grounded shields and grounding all of the electronic boxes to each other and to the boat (battery ground). Try to eliminate any unshielded oppertunities.
